Synopsis: Up to 7% of B burgdorferi infections in the United States are asymptomatic.
-
Synopsis: Human metapneumovirus was found in 6.4% of respiratory tract specimens collected from children < 5 years of age who had no evidence of other respiratory tract pathogens.

In response to recommendations from the Ameri-can Heart Association (AHA), in 1999 the Joint Commission on Accreditation of Healthcare Organizations added a requirement for review of cardiopulmonary resuscitation (CPR) to the hospital performance improvement standard.
